Job description

We’re seeking a Student Nurse Aide to join our growing team!Reliability, trustworthiness and consistency with regard to attendance is extremely important to this job. The ability to regularly and timely attend work, cooperative and politely work and deal with others, and to effectively multi-task and work in a stressful environment are also essential functions to this job.

Responsibilities:

  • Only perform patient care areas for which the student has received training.
  • Accountable for personal care (i.e., grooming, bathing, catheter care, peri care,dressing), and observation of residents within patient care policy guidelines.
  • Identify and report any condition requiring management attention.
  • Change bed linen and maintain appropriate grooming supplies in resident room.
  • Ambulate and transfer residents, utilizing appropriate assistive devices and bodymechanics.
  • Routinely turn and position patients.
  • Provide support to the nursing department by assisting with non-nursing tasks, including,but not limited to bed-making, passing water/ice, answering call lights, and gatheringsupplies.
  • Perform range of motion and reality orientation with residents as directed.

Qualifications:

  • Must provide written proof of completion of 16hr ADL training by an authorizedSchool/Instructor.
  • Basic computer knowledge.
  • Good communication skills with excellent self-discipline and patience.
  • Ability to comply with the Patient Bill of Rights and the Employee Responsibilities.
  • Ability to comply with Company and departmental safety policies and procedures.
